Judging parameters

Every entry is scored out of 100 on five weighted parameters. Platform-verified data is used wherever it exists.

  1. 30%

    Assessment maturity

    Verified score from the platform maturity assessment across the nominee's persona set.

  2. 25%

    Outcome & ROI evidence

    Documented business impact—cost, revenue, risk or cycle-time—attributable to the initiative.

  3. 20%

    Capability building

    Training completion, certification depth and internal enablement reach.

  4. 15%

    Deployment maturity

    MVPs in production, governance posture and monitoring discipline.

  5. 10%

    Ecosystem contribution

    Published work, mentorship, open collaboration and standards participation.

Guidelines

  • 01Nominations are open to individuals, teams, organisations and institutions operating in the current financial year.
  • 02Self-nomination is permitted; a second endorser from outside the nominee's reporting line is required.
  • 03Evidence must be verifiable—links, dashboards, audited figures or a named reference contact.
  • 04Nominees who have completed a platform assessment are auto-scored; others are scored on submitted evidence only.
  • 05Jury decisions are final. Shortlists are published before the ceremony; scores stay confidential.
  • 06Any material misstatement disqualifies the entry and voids the associated fee.
